- Willow TV: Willow TV is a dedicated cricket streaming service that offers live coverage of cricket matches from around the world.
- Hotstar: Hotstar is a popular streaming service that features live cricket, particularly matches involving the Indian cricket team.
- Sky Sports Cricket: If you’re in the UK, Sky Sports Cricket is a great option for watching live cricket.
- Free Sports: Free Sports is a free-to-air channel in the UK that occasionally broadcasts live cricket matches.

Understanding ESPN's Cricket Coverage
First off, let’s clarify ESPN's coverage of cricket. ESPN has been a significant player in broadcasting various sports, and cricket is no exception. However, the availability of live cricket on ESPN depends on several factors, including broadcasting rights, specific ESPN channels, and your geographical location.
Typically, ESPN acquires rights for major international cricket tournaments and series. This includes events like the ICC Cricket World Cup, T20 World Cup, and bilateral series featuring prominent cricket-playing nations such as India, Australia, England, and South Africa. When these events are on, you'll likely find live coverage on ESPN channels. But remember, it's not always a guarantee, so you need to check the listings.
To find out exactly what cricket is being shown, the best approach is to check ESPN's official schedule. This can be done through their website or the ESPN app. These platforms provide the most accurate and up-to-date information on what's being broadcasted. Also, keep an eye on sports news and announcements leading up to major cricket events. ESPN usually publicizes their broadcasting schedule well in advance, so you have plenty of time to plan your viewing. Keep in mind that ESPN's coverage can vary significantly based on regional rights agreements. What's available in the US might differ from what's available in other parts of the world. So, always tailor your search to your specific location.

4. Streaming Services with ESPN
Several streaming services include ESPN in their channel lineup. Services like Sling TV, Hulu + Live TV, YouTube TV, and FuboTV offer ESPN as part of their packages. By subscribing to one of these services, you can stream live cricket matches on ESPN without needing a traditional cable subscription. These services often come with additional perks like DVR storage, multiple device streaming, and on-demand content. This makes them a flexible and cost-effective alternative to traditional cable.
